Updating

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Cape Town apartments: Rent holiday apartments in Cape Town

All filters

Filters (1)

Clear filters

735 apartments

Applied filters (1)

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 6

from £172 / night

£1,203 / week

1 / 41

Holiday apartment with shared pool in Muizenberg

Muizenberg ap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£130 / night

£878 / week

1 / 26

Apartment rental in Fish Hoek with shared pool

Fish Hoek ap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£74 / night

£462 - £979 / week

1 / 19

Holiday apartment in Bantry Bay

Bantry Bay apartment

  • 1 bedroom
  • 2 bathrooms
  • sleeps 3

from £162 / night

£1,067 / week

1 / 15

Holiday apartment in Strand

Strand ap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 3

from £93 / night

£647 / week

1 / 8

Apartment letting in Cape Town Central

Cape Town Central ap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£231 / night

£1,617 / week

1 / 11

Holiday apartment in Bakoven

Bakoven apartment

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 8

from £252 / night

£1,764 / week

1 / 51

Holiday apartment with shared pool in Somerset West

Somerset West ap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£38 / night

£263 / week

1 / 7

Green Point holiday apartment rental

Green Point ap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£63 / night

£440 / week

1 / 16

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£79 / night

£462 / week

1 / 5

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£88 / night

£615 / week

1 / 14

Gordon's Bay holiday apartment let

Gordon's Bay ap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£125 / night

£656 - £961 / week

1 / 41

Holiday apartment with shared pool in Edgemead

Edgemead ap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£42 / night

£291 / week

1 / 21

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£47 / night

£277 / week

1 / 7

Hout Bay holiday apartment rental

Hout Bay ap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£74 / night

£518 / week

1 / 9

Apartment rental in Bakoven with swimming pool

Bakoven apartment

  • 2 bedrooms
  • 4 bathrooms
  • sleeps 4

from £693 / night

£3,556 / week

1 / 4

Holiday apartment with shared pool in Bloubergstrand

Bloubergstrand ap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£56 / night

£374 / week

1 / 35

Holiday apartment in Muizenberg

Muizenberg ap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£134 / night

£905 / week

1 / 25

Holiday apartment with shared pool in Cape Town Central

Cape Town Central ap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£162 / night

£1,132 / week

1 / 8

Holiday apartment with shared pool in Strand

Strand ap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 5

from £79 / night

£508 / week

1 / 39

Holiday apartment with shared pool in Milnerton

Milnerton ap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£149 / night

£1,041 / week

1 / 13

Holiday apartment in Muizenberg

Muizenberg ap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£46 / night

£301 / week

1 / 6

Holiday apartment with shared pool in Gordon's Bay

Gordon's Bay ap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£93 / night

£462 / week

1 / 7

Apartment rental in Camps Bay

Camps Bay apartment

  • 6 bedrooms
  • 6 bathrooms
  • sleeps 12

from £800 / night

£5,600 / week

1 / 36

Holiday apartment in Green Point

Green Point apartment

  • 1 bedroom
  • 2 bathrooms
  • sleeps 4

from £56 / night

£333 - £527 / week

1 / 9

Holiday apartment in Bloubergstrand

Bloubergstrand ap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£69 / night

£481 / week

1 / 10

Holiday apartment with swimming pool in Oranjezicht

Oranjezicht ap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£229 / night

£1,374 / week

1 / 28

Kommetjie holiday apartment rental

Kommetjie ap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£59 / night

£364 / week

1 / 14

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£92 / night

£640 / week

1 / 20

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£79 / night

£462 / week

1 / 20

Llandudno holiday apartment rental

Llandudno ap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£227 / night

£1,557 / week

1 / 14

Holiday apartment with shared pool in Noordhoek

Noordhoek ap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£52 / night

£344 / week

1 / 10

Holiday apartment in Cape Town Central

Cape Town Central ap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£29 / night

£172 / week

1 / 5

Holiday apartment in Fish Hoek

Fish Hoek ap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£46 / night

£287 / week

1 / 5

Holiday apartment with shared pool in Bloubergstrand

Bloubergstrand ap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£102 / night

£555 / week

1 / 20

Cape Town Central holiday apartment let

Cape Town Central ap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£81 / night

£561 / week

1 / 37

Bloubergstrand holiday apartment rental

Bloubergstrand ap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£116 / night

£762 / week

1 / 23

Camps Bay holiday apartment rental

Camps Bay ap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£400 / night

£2,800 / week

1 / 20

Green Point holiday apartment rental

Green Point apartment

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 10

from £277 / night

£1,940 / week

1 / 43

Holiday apartment with shared pool in Bloubergstrand

Bloubergstrand ap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 4

from £115 / night

£802 / week

1 / 12

×

Also consider